In the table below, a check mark indicates a function that can be changed, while — indicates function
that cannot be changed.
The icons below [Self-Timer] and [Flash] indicate the available modes.
When the shooting modes below are registered and recalled in

(Memory recall mode), the

conditions for whether settings can be changed or not remain the same as in the table below.
